According to the online car market report, it has been learned from Stellantis Group insiders that Opel is discussing a cooperation with Dongfeng Group and will return to the Chinese market as a domestic company in the future. Its models are co-produced with DPCA and will be built on the same platform. However, as of press time, Stellantis Group and Dongfeng Group have not responded publicly.

According to the data, Opel was founded in 1862, but at first it only made sewing machines and bicycles, but it did not start producing cars until 1899, and it was not a sub-brand of any automobile group at that time. Opel sold 80% of its shares to GM in 1929 and the remaining 20% to GM in 1931, and has since become a sub-brand of the same car, with the main market in European countries.

As the first brand to enter the Chinese market, Opel is no stranger to Chinese consumers. In 1993, Euler entered the Chinese market and successively introduced a number of products such as Yingsuya, all-new Saifei, Merina and the new Aart GTC, but because the Opel model was built on the platform of Buick, its sales in the domestic market were not hot and the market performance was not satisfactory. based on GM's global strategic layout, it decided to stop the sales business of the Opel brand in China and finally announced its withdrawal from the Chinese market in 2015. After withdrawing from China, Opel was sold to Peugeot Citroen in 2017 because of continued losses, and led Opel to turn a profit in 2018.

In fact, as early as 2019, there was news that Opel would be made in China. At that time, Citroen Group (PSA) and Fiat Chrysler Group (FCA) were seeking a merger, while Dongfeng Group, as the third largest shareholder of PSA Group, would reduce its stake in PSA to help PSA and FCA merge smoothly. It is understood that Dongfeng Group holds 12.2% of PSA Group shares, worth about 2.2 billion euros. After the merger of FCA and PSA, Dongfeng Group will own 4.5% of the new company, making it the third largest shareholder.

At that time, according to media reports, Dongfeng Group had reached an agreement with PSA Group to extend the term of the joint venture DPCA, and planned to introduce Opel to the Chinese market. If agreed, DFG would have exclusive rights to the brand and benefit from the new technology and intellectual property rights of the new company after the merger.

According to the current information, if Opel is successfully made in China, it may become a pure electric brand. It is understood that Stellantis Group has STLA S, STLA M, STLA L and STLA F new electric platforms, covering small cars, medium-sized cars, pickups and other models, with a range of 500-800km. Future Peugeot, Citroen, DS and Opel electric vehicles will be built on these platforms. According to foreign media reports, Opel is expected to launch an all-electric car Manta E around 2025 and will return to the Chinese market with an all-electric car lineup in the same year.

In July 2021, at the EV Day held by Stellantis Group, the Opel brand of the Group released the official picture of the new Manta-e concept car. As one of the classic models of the Opel brand, Manta will also fully start the electrification transformation of the Opel brand. While releasing new models, the Opel brand also makes plans for the future development of the enterprise. Opel said it would reshape its brand image to make it a younger, greener global brand. Michael Lohscheller, CEO of Opel, also said that starting from 2024, all Opel brand models will be electrified. By 2028, Opel will be fully electrified in the European market, and Opel will be the first to launch nine models this year. In addition, it also said, "We will return to China and bring 100% Opel pure electric vehicles."

At present, China is the world's largest automobile market and the largest new energy vehicle market, and Opel plans to return to China's position in the global market. Of course, it also depends on the overall strategy of the parent company Stellantis Group. It is understood that in March this year, the Stellantis Group will announce the specific measures of the China strategy, when the plans for the introduction of Opel and other brands into China may be revealed.
